The island has been influenced by the French, the Dutch, the British, the Spanish and even the Knights of Malta, which could explain its rich cultural diversity.
Rum distilleries, sugar mills and once majestic plantation houses can be seen all over St. Croix, and arts, crafts and music festivals are held throughout the year.
While not as glamorous as St. Thomas, St. Croix still has plenty of entertainment options including a casino, amazing restaurants, several golf courses and, of course, stunning beaches.

Travelers 1 2 3 4 5 6. British Virgin Islands Today, November 14, Virgin Gorda. Tortola, the largest of the 16 inhabited islands, is home to more than three quarters of the population. Named by Christopher Columbus in , the islands were settled by the Dutch until They became part of Britain's Leeward Islands colony in , gaining a limited degree of self-rule in A new constitution adopted in established a greater degree of self-government.
Tourism and offshore finance dominate the economy, with financial and business services accounting for nearly half of the islands' GDP. A huge leak in of documents known as the "Panama Papers" revealed the islands to be the most popular tax haven by far with clients of the Panamanian law firm, Mossack Fonseca. The British Virgin Islands comprise around sixty tropical Caribbean islands, ranging in size from the largest, Tortola 20 km 12 mi long and 5 km 3 mi wide, to tiny uninhabited islets.
Most of the islands are volcanic in origin and have a hilly, rugged terrain. Anegada is geologically distinct from the rest of the group and is a flat island composed of limestone and coral.
Politics The Territory operates as a parliamentary democracy. The Governor is appointed by the Queen on the advice of the British Government. Defence and most Foreign Affairs remain the responsibility of the United Kingdom.
